автоматично попълване на компанията на Linkedin (автоматично попълване)

Опитвам се да накарам автоматичното довършване да работи в приложението ми, когато търся компании. В моя случай търся "ska" Три (3) различни сценария:

1 - Отидете на https://www.linkedin.com/ta/federator?types=company&query=ska във вашия браузър. Резултат: Получавате json отговор с данни.

2. Опитайте да го извикате чрез javascript Front-End

        $("#birds").autocomplete({
            minLength: 3,
            source: function (request, response) {
                // request.term is the term searched for.
                // response is the callback function you must call to update the autocomplete's 
                // suggestion list.
                $.ajax({
                    url: "https://www.linkedin.com/ta/federator?types=company",
                    data: { query: request.term },
                    dataType: "json",
                    success: response,
                    error: function () {
                        response([]);
                    }
                });
            }

        });

Резултат: нула

Сценарий 3:

Обадете се на LinkedIn API с вашия API и таен ключ. API извикване на „company-search?keywords={your-partial-word}“ Резултат: Попаденията при търсене не приличат на автоматичното довършване. Предложенията за автоматично довършване са много по-добри.

Предложения как да създадете автоматично попълване за LinkedIn, когато търсите само компании.

Както споменахме, има два различни начина.

  1. Извикване на https://www.linkedin.com/ta/federator?types=company&query={име}
  2. Използване на LinkedIn API - не е добър или очакван резултат, както е показано при използване (1)

person Radek82    schedule 09.03.2015    source източник
comment
това законно ли е да се използва?   -  person CoderKK    schedule 22.08.2016


Отговори (1)


Мисля, че добър начин да направите това е:

  1. Изградете локален сървър, който може да обработи заявката ви за заявка и да изпрати заявката ви до linkedin query url (Това ще елиминира проблема с CORS)
  2. В този js код за автоматично довършване задайте URL адреса да бъде вашият локален сървър.
person VELVETDETH    schedule 30.07.2015